The copyright Experience: User Accounts and Scientific Inquiry
The remarkable copyright trip remains a subject of intense fascination for both recreational users and the academic community. Narratives from individuals who have used copyright frequently describe vivid visions , altered perceptions of time , and a deep feeling of connection to something greater . While personal accounts offer powerful glimpses into the experience, they are unavoidably limited in their ability to provide definitive data. Therefore , ongoing scientific studies are attempting to correlate these subjective reports with measurable neurological changes, particularly focusing on brain activity and the role of the default mode network . In the end, a combined approach—respecting both the personal nature of the experience and the need for objective validation—is necessary to truly know the potential of copyright.
